Understanding Workers’ Compensation Benefits in Bakersfield

 

Bakersfield, located in the heart of California’s Central Valley, is known for its robust agricultural industry, oil production, and growing healthcare sector. Each of these industries comes with its own set of occupational hazards, making workplace injuries a common concern in the region. Some of the most common workplace injuries we handle at Laguna Law Firm include:

 

1. Agricultural Injuries

Agriculture is a major industry in Bakersfield, and farm workers are often exposed to significant risks, including heavy machinery, chemical exposure, and repetitive motions. Common injuries in this sector include fractures, respiratory issues, musculoskeletal disorders, and heat-related illnesses.

2. Oil and Gas Industry Accidents

Bakersfield is home to some of California’s largest oil fields, and workers in this industry face unique dangers, such as explosions, fires, and exposure to hazardous chemicals. Injuries in the oil and gas sector often include burns, traumatic brain injuries, and respiratory conditions.

3. Repetitive Strain Injuries (RSIs)

Repetitive strain injuries, such as tendinitis and carpal tunnel syndrome, are common in jobs that require repetitive motions or sustained physical exertion. These injuries can lead to chronic pain and long-term disability if not addressed properly.

4. Healthcare-Related Injuries

With a growing healthcare sector in Bakersfield, healthcare workers are at risk of injuries related to patient handling, exposure to infectious diseases, and repetitive tasks. Common injuries include back strains, needle-stick injuries, and slips and falls.

5. Transportation and Warehouse Accidents

Bakersfield’s location along major transportation routes makes it a hub for logistics and warehousing. Workers in these industries face risks such as forklift accidents, loading and unloading injuries, and motor vehicle collisions.

 

Living and Working in Bakersfield: Unique Considerations for Workers

Bakersfield, with its diverse economy and strategic location, offers a unique work environment for its residents. Understanding the specific aspects of living and working in Bakersfield can help you navigate your workers’ compensation claim more effectively.

 

1. Agriculture and Oil: The Backbone of Bakersfield’s Economy

Bakersfield is a leading center for agriculture and oil production in California. These industries are essential to the local economy but also come with significant risks for workers. Agricultural workers, often employed in physically demanding roles, are prone to injuries from machinery, pesticides, and extreme weather conditions. Meanwhile, oil workers face the dangers of working with highly flammable materials and heavy equipment.

2. Bakersfield’s Climate and Heat-Related Injuries

Bakersfield experiences hot, dry summers, with temperatures often exceeding 100 degrees Fahrenheit. For outdoor workers, particularly those in agriculture and construction, the extreme heat poses a serious risk of heat-related illnesses such as heat exhaustion and heatstroke. It’s crucial for workers in these industries to be aware of their rights to workers’ compensation benefits if they suffer from heat-related conditions.

3. Rural and Urban Mix: Diverse Work Environments

Bakersfield offers a mix of rural and urban environments, each with its own set of occupational risks. In the rural areas, agricultural work is prevalent, while the urban center sees a concentration of jobs in healthcare, retail, and education. Understanding the specific risks associated with your work environment is key to securing the appropriate workers’ compensation benefits.

4. Cost of Living and the Importance of Full Compensation

While the cost of living in Bakersfield is generally lower than in coastal California cities, securing adequate workers’ compensation benefits is still essential to maintaining financial stability. For many workers, especially those with long-term injuries, the compensation received can be the difference between maintaining their quality of life and facing financial hardship.

5. Language Diversity and Accessibility

Bakersfield has a significant Hispanic population, and Spanish is widely spoken in the community. Language barriers can sometimes complicate the workers’ compensation process, especially when it comes to understanding legal rights and navigating the claims process. Temporary Disability Benefits

If your injury prevents you from working temporarily, you may be entitled to temporary disability (TD) benefits. These benefits are designed to replace a portion of your lost wages while you recover. In California, TD benefits are generally two-thirds of your average weekly wages, up to a maximum limit set by the state.

Supplemental Job Displacement Benefits

If your injury prevents you from returning to your previous job, you may qualify for Supplemental Job Displacement Benefits (SJDB). This benefit provides a voucher that can be used for education, retraining, or skill enhancement at an accredited school or training program.
